What Is A Celebrant?
This is a question I get asked all the time. As a Celebrant I am not bound by any religion, statute or doctrine, meaning I am able to construct and perform completely personalised ceremonies for clients. Whilst I may have a personal belief, these beliefs are just that: personal.
Most officiants, religious and registrars have rules to abide by, my Celebrant ceremonies can contain any wording at all, whether it be religious, spiritual or personal. It is often a combination of all three, but ultimately, it’s whatever the client wants.
Celebrant ceremonies are about those who the ceremony is for, telling the story of the client, not the ideologies of religion. They will often include some humour and celebrate the person or couples’ life and are usually personalised and unique.
As a Celebrant I am a highly professional and accomplished public speaker and can deliver ceremonies in a variety of venues and situations, from meadows and fields to chapels and village halls, whatever the occasion I lead ceremonies wherever the client chooses.

Weddings and Family occasions
- Weddings
When couples are looking for a less formal, relaxed inclusive atmosphere, or indeed plan to marry at a venue which does not hold a marriage licence, then a Celebrant can be a great option.
Although I can create and conduct personalised weddings, a Celebrant cannot legally marry a couple. They’d need to visit a registrar in order to arrange the more formal side of things.

FREEDOM OF CHOICE
But what you might not know, is that you with an Independent Celebrant you also have the freedom to decide:
Where you get married
It does not have to be a licensed venue. You can choose somewhere that is special to you both, whether that’s a pretty garden, woodland, by a lake, on a beach, or in a special eatery with happy memories attached. All you need is the land, or venue owner’s, permission.
What time you get married
Your Celebrant is yours all day. That means you can be very flexible about your timings. Celebrants only ever commit to doing one marriage ceremony a day, so they won’t be rushing you or popping off somewhere else during your special day.
How long your ceremony will last
However long you want it to. Whilst most celebrant led wedding ceremonies last between 20 and 40 minutes, if you want additional elements to be included in your ceremony, then that’s fine. You have no time limit, just to reemphasise, your Celebrant is yours all day.
How your ceremony will be structured
However you want it to be structured. Whilst there is a basic structure, you can tweak it so that it is further personalised and recognises your own values, beliefs and personality. If you want to add in someone to sing, play an instrument, dance or do performance poetry, then you can.
To write your own vows
You don’t have to recite any special vows, or use ones written by your Celebrant for you. By writing your own, you can take your ceremony to the next level, plus if you keep them secret from your partner, that can often make your day even more special.
What you want to say, or be said about you
Working with your Celebrant you can decide what words/phrases you would like to be used in your wedding ceremony. Your Celebrant will spend time with you getting to know you and will write a ceremony that reflects you as a couple. You can tweak it until you are 100% happy with it.
Who you want to be involved
You can invite as many, or as few, people as you would like to help you celebrate your special day. And if you want others to do readings, sing or actively take part in other activities, then ask them, remember this is your opportunity to have a totally unique event.
Any other individual elements you may want to be included in your ceremony
Once again the choice is yours when it comes to themes or rituals. There are plenty to choose from, everything from handfasting to sand and from candles to jumping the broom.
